Prevádzka Caas (Container as a Service) služby pre Volkswagen Group
Kľúčové body:
✓ CaaS zlepšil správu Kubernetes a znížil náklady pre Volkswagen Group.
✓ Riešenie prinieslo vyššiu škálovateľnosť a dostupnosť služieb.
✓ Automatizácia a monitoring zvýšili efektivitu IT procesov.
✓ Dostupnosť služieb vzrástla na 99,9 %, znížili sa náklady.
✓ Projekt podporuje digitálnu transformáciu a inováciu v IT.
12. marec 2022 ┃ 7 minút čítania
Automobilové spoločnosti sú pod tlakom, aby prispôsobili svoju IT infraštruktúru rastúcim požiadavkám na rýchlosť, flexibilitu a efektívnosť. Tradičné metódy správy aplikácií a služieb často nedokážu držať krok s trendmi. Kontajnerizácia a orchestrácia pomocou Kubernetes sa stali kľúčovými technológiami pre modernizáciu IT infraštruktúry.
Trend v odvetví smeruje k adopcii cloudových riešení a automatizácii IT procesov. Container as a Service (CaaS) predstavuje evolúciu v tejto oblasti, poskytujúc platformu, ktorá zjednodušuje nasadenie, správu a škálovanie kontajnerizovaných aplikácií. Tento prístup umožňuje spoločnostiam sústrediť sa na vývoj a inovácie, zatiaľ čo komplexnosť infraštruktúry je abstrahovaná a automatizovaná.
Klient
Výzvy
Volkswagen Group čelil niekoľkým kľúčovým výzvam v oblasti IT infraštruktúry. Hlavným problémom bola potreba efektívnejšej správy a prevádzky Kubernetes clustera, ktorý je kritický pre mnohé moderné aplikácie a služby spoločnosti. Tradičné metódy správy clustera boli časovo náročné, náchylné na chyby a nedostatočne škálovateľné vzhľadom na rastúce potreby spoločnosti.
Ďalšou výzvou bola optimalizácia využitia zdrojov a zníženie celkových nákladov na infraštruktúru. Volkswagen Group potreboval riešenie, ktoré by umožnilo elastické škálovanie zdrojov podľa aktuálnych potrieb, čím by sa eliminovalo plytvanie a zároveň zabezpečila vysoká dostupnosť služieb.
Navyše, zabezpečenie kontinuálnej dostupnosti služieb počas aktualizácií a zmien v konfiguráciách predstavovalo značnú technickú výzvu. Bolo potrebné nájsť spôsob, ako implementovať zmeny a aktualizácie bez narušenia prevádzky kritických systémov.
Volkswagen Group si stanovil nasledujúce ciele pre projekt implementácie Container as a Service (CaaS):
- Automatizovať správu Kubernetes clustera s cieľom zvýšiť efektivitu a znížiť manuálne zásahy.
- Dosiahnuť vysokú elasticitu a dostupnosť služieb, umožňujúc rýchle prispôsobenie sa meniacim sa požiadavkám.
- Optimalizovať využitie zdrojov a znížiť celkové náklady na infraštruktúru.
- Zabezpečiť spoľahlivý monitoring a riadenie výkonu Kubernetes clustera.
- Implementovať robustný systém pre kontinuálne aktualizácie a zmeny konfigurácií bez narušenia prevádzky.
Riešenie
Pre dosiahnutie stanovených cieľov bolo navrhnuté a implementované komplexné Container as a Service (CaaS) riešenie. Toto riešenie zahŕňalo nasadenie a prevádzku pokročilej platformy pre správu Kubernetes clustera, ktorá automatizovala kľúčové procesy a poskytla potrebnú flexibilitu a škálovateľnosť.
Technické riešenie pozostávalo z niekoľkých kľúčových komponentov:
- Automatizovaná správa clustera: Implementácia nástrojov pre automatické nasadzovanie, škálovanie a aktualizáciu Kubernetes clustera, čím sa eliminovala potreba manuálnych zásahov a znížilo sa riziko ľudských chýb.
- Dynamické škálovanie: Vytvorenie systému, ktorý automaticky prispôsobuje kapacitu clustera na základe aktuálneho zaťaženia, čím sa optimalizuje využitie zdrojov a znižujú sa náklady.
- Pokročilý monitoring a alerting: Nasadenie komplexného monitorovacieho riešenia, ktoré poskytuje v reálnom čase prehľad o stave clustera, výkone aplikácií a využití zdrojov. Tento systém umožňuje proaktívne riešenie potenciálnych problémov.
- Robustné testovacie prostredie: Vytvorenie izolovaného testovacieho prostredia, ktoré presne replikuje produkčné nastavenia. Toto umožňuje dôkladné testovanie všetkých zmien a aktualizácií pred ich nasadením do produkcie.
- Automatizované zálohovanie a obnova: Implementácia systému pre pravidelné zálohovanie konfigurácie clustera a kritických dát, s možnosťou rýchlej obnovy v prípade potreby.
Implementácia tohto riešenia prebiehala v niekoľkých fázach, začínajúc dôkladnou analýzou existujúcej infraštruktúry a požiadaviek. Následne bolo vytvorené pilotné prostredie pre overenie konceptu, po ktorom nasledovalo postupné nasadzovanie v produkčnom prostredí.
Výzvy a prekonanie problémov
- Zaistenie kontinuálnej dostupnosti: Jednou z hlavných výziev bolo zabezpečiť nepretržitú dostupnosť služieb počas aktualizácií a zmien v konfiguráciách. Tento problém bol vyriešený implementáciou stratégie postupného nasadzovania (rolling updates) a využitím pokročilých techník ako blue-green deployments. Tieto prístupy umožnili vykonávať zmeny s minimálnym dopadom na prevádzku.
- Komplexnosť migrácie existujúcich aplikácií: Presun existujúcich aplikácií do nového CaaS prostredia predstavoval značnú výzvu. Riešením bolo vytvorenie detailného migračného plánu pre každú aplikáciu, ktorý zahŕňal analýzu závislostí, optimalizáciu kódu pre kontajnerizáciu a postupné testovanie v izolovanom prostredí.
- Zabezpečenie a compliance: Implementácia robustných bezpečnostných opatrení a dodržiavanie prísnych regulačných požiadaviek v automobilovom priemysle boli kľúčové. Tento problém bol adresovaný nasadením pokročilých bezpečnostných nástrojov, implementáciou prísnych politík prístupu a pravidelným auditom bezpečnosti.
- Optimalizácia výkonu: Dosiahnutie optimálneho výkonu v distribuovanom prostredí Kubernetes vyžadovalo značné úsilie. Riešením bolo nasadenie pokročilých nástrojov pre analýzu výkonu, optimalizácia konfigurácie clustera a implementácia automatického škálovania na základe definovaných metrík.
- Školenie a adaptácia tímu: Prechod na nové CaaS riešenie vyžadoval značné zmeny v pracovných postupoch IT tímu. Tento problém bol riešený prostredníctvom komplexného školiaceho programu, vytvorením detailnej dokumentácie a poskytnutím priebežnej podpory počas adaptačného obdobia.
Výsledky
Implementácia Container as a Service (CaaS) riešenia priniesla Volkswagen Group významné a merateľné výsledky. Dostupnosť služieb sa dramaticky zlepšila, dosahujúc impozantnú úroveň 99,9%. Táto vysoká miera dostupnosti zabezpečila, že kritické systémy a aplikácie zostali funkčné prakticky nepretržite, čo malo priamy pozitívny dopad na prevádzkovú efektivitu celej spoločnosti.
Jedným z najvýznamnejších úspechov projektu bolo dosiahnutie zníženia nákladov na infraštruktúru. Toto zníženie bolo dosiahnuté vďaka optimalizácii využitia zdrojov, ktorú umožnilo CaaS riešenie. Automatické škálovanie a efektívne prideľovanie výpočtových zdrojov viedli k eliminácii plytvania a lepšiemu využitiu dostupnej kapacity.
Okrem týchto kvantitatívnych výsledkov, projekt priniesol aj rad kvalitatívnych zlepšení. IT tímy zaznamenali výrazné zvýšenie produktivity vďaka automatizácii rutinných úloh spojených so správou Kubernetes clustera. Čas potrebný na nasadenie nových aplikácií a služieb sa významne skrátil, čo umožnilo rýchlejšiu reakciu na meniace sa požiadavky trhu.
Volkswagen Group ocenil spoľahlivosť a efektivitu nasadeného riešenia. Flexibilita a škálovateľnosť nového systému boli označené za kľúčové faktory, ktoré podporujú dlhodobú stratégiu digitálnej transformácie spoločnosti. IT tímy Volkswagen Group tiež pozitívne hodnotili zlepšenú viditeľnosť a kontrolu nad infraštruktúrou, ktorú poskytli pokročilé monitorovacie nástroje implementované ako súčasť CaaS riešenia. Toto umožnilo proaktívne riešenie potenciálnych problémov a optimalizáciu výkonu systému.
Kľúčové dopady projektu zahŕňajú:
✓ Dramatické zlepšenie dostupnosti služieb na úroveň 99,9%, čo zabezpečilo nepretržitú prevádzku kritických systémov.
✓ Významné zníženie nákladov na infraštruktúru, dosiahnuté vďaka optimalizácii využitia zdrojov.
✓ Zvýšenie agility IT oddelenia, umožňujúce rýchlejšie nasadzovanie nových aplikácií a služieb.
✓ Zlepšenie prevádzkovej efektivity vďaka automatizácii rutinných úloh správy Kubernetes clustera.
✓ Zvýšenie viditeľnosti a kontroly nad IT infraštruktúrou, umožňujúce proaktívne riešenie problémov.
Záver
Prihláste sa na odber a neunikne vám žiadny článok
Ak sa vám článok páčil, zdieľajte ho
Ďalšie články, ktoré by sa vám mohli páčiť